Gold-Catalyzed Cycloisomerization of Alkyne-Containing Amino Acids: Controlled Tuning of C–N vs. C–O Reactivity
Medran, Noelia S.,Villalba, Matías,Mata, Ernesto G.,Testero, Sebastián A.
, p. 3757 - 3764 (2016/08/16)
Versatile alkyne-containing amino acids were used as ambident precursors in the divergent synthesis of alkylidenelactones and 1-pyrrolines. Two gold-catalyzed protocols were applied for selective intramolecular O- and N-cycloisomerization reactions.

An approach to 2,3-dihydropyrroles and β-iodopyrroles based on 5-endo-dig cyclisations
Knight, David W.,Redfern, Adele L.,Gilmore, Jeremy
, p. 622 - 628 (2007/10/03)
A representative series of homopropargylic sulfonamides 19 and 22b have been found to undergo smooth 5-endo-dig cyclisation upon exposure to excess iodine in acetonitrile containing potassium carbonate. The resulting 4-iodo-2,3-dihydropyrroles 23 readily react with two equivalents of DBU in DMF at 20°C to give the corresponding β-iodopyrroles 24 and 26 in excellent yields by the elimination of toluene-p-sulfinic acid. Use of less than two equivalents of base results in some loss of iodine. The iodo-2,3-dihydropyrroles 23 can be used in palladium-catalysed coupling reactions as shown by the efficient formation of the Sonogashira product 29 under mild conditions.

Solid phase synthesis of fused bicyclic amino acid derivatives via intramolecular Pauson-Khand cyclization: Versatile scaffolds for combinatorial chemistry
Bolton, Gary L.,Hodges, John C.,Rubin, J. Ronald
, p. 6611 - 6634 (2007/10/03)
Solution and solid phase synthetic methods leading to the rapid, stereocontrolled construction of highly functionalized fused bicyclic amino acid derivatives have been developed. The key step involves a unique application of the intramolecular Pauson-Khand cyclization for the construction of hexahydro-1H-[2]pyrindinone ring systems. Further modifications which demonstrate the potential for combinatorial library generation are also disclosed.
